Mattie Ross (pictured) ran with great credit in the mares maiden hurdle at Hereford yesterday finishing fourth on ground that was too sticky for her and on a track that was too sharp.  She is now qualified for handicaps and hopefully we can find a race on a more suitable track for her in future.

With Tom Bellamy unable to do the weight on Elfride, Sam Twiston-Davies stood in for him but unfortunately the mare was too enthusiastic at the first and came down.  Apart from a cut on her heel she appears fine, as does Sam and we hope to get her back to winning ways soon.

Lizzie Rey runs today at Ludlow in the ‘Luke Watson Memorial’ maiden hurdle run at 3.20pm.    Luke was a popular member of the team at Adlestrop Stables and we have our cricket match in memory of him each year.  Lizzie ran on well up the straight at Doncaster on her hurdling debut recently but was a little green early on.  Hopefully she has learned from the experience and looks like a staying hurdler in the making.
